Basic tier for validation and fast learning

The basic tier is designed to prove which pages and angles respond to authority. It typically focuses on a small number of targets—one primary money page plus two to four supporting pages—and delivers a limited set of contextual placements on niche-relevant igaming outlets that meet baseline DR and traffic requirements. The goal is learning: which publishers index quickly, which content formats earn clicks, and which landing pages convert. Basic is ideal for new brands, new geos, or fresh content hubs that need initial traction without overcommitting budget.

How to choose tiers using data, not guesswork

Tie tier selection to difficulty and ROI. Use basic to validate the cluster and publisher roster, standard to build consistent authority flow, and pro/enterprise to push the most competitive pages. Measure with UTMs for referral sessions and micro-conversions (signups, account creation), then confirm SEO lift in Search Console via impression/CTR changes and ranking deltas correlated with publish dates. When data shows which publishers and angles drive both rankings and referrals, upgrades become an ROI decision instead of a leap of faith.
